00:00Middlesbrough began their championship campaign and their first match under Robert Edwards
00:05with a victory over Welsh side Swansea City.
00:081-0 was the final score with Dale Fry, a local lad from Teesside,
00:12scoring in the second half to give the borough all three points.
00:17It was, of course, a repeat of the fixture that began last season's championship
00:20for both clubs at the Riverside, with that game also ending 1-0 to Middlesbrough.
00:25So, from Edwards has done what Michael Carrick did this time last year.
00:30However, following that, of course, Michael Carrick failed to get Middlesbrough into the playoffs
00:34come the end of last season.
00:36Robert Edwards will be looking to be different when it comes to the outcome of this season.
00:40Will he do it?
00:41Well, there's a lot of football still to be played, but it certainly was a good start
00:45with Dale Fry heading in the winner for Borough.
